Honeywell Garrett G-Series - The newest and most advanced generation turbocharger!
These very small turbochargers achieve extremely high performance with minimum space requirements.
- G45-1125 compressor aero increases flow up to 10% (compared to GTX4502R 67mm)
- 67mm compressor inducer | 102mm compressor exducer
- G Series turbine aero increases flow 14% (compared to GTX45R)
- Inconel turbine wheel with 89mm inducer flows up to 56 lbs/min
- Latest CFD-optimized, forged milled compressor wheel
- High-Flow compressor housing with integrated easy plug speed sensor port
- Rotation: Standard (Clockwise)
- Dual ceramic ball bearing cartridges
- Lightweight aluminum backplate
- Inconel 950°C turbine wheel
- 950°C Stainless Steel turbine housing available
- Water- and Oil cooled
- External Wastegate

The center section is attached to the exhaust housing over an V-band and can thus easily rotate 360° into any position.
Four large water connection options allow high cooling water throughput and easy installation of the supply and discharge lines via two supplied -6AN adapters.
For the first time the use of twin piston ring seals on the compressor and turbine side, which significantly reduce any oil leaks from the bearing housing.
The completely redesigned turbine wheel, made of the high-performance material Inconel, enables exhaust gas temperatures up to 950° C.
All G-45 turbine housings are made of stainless steel and temperature-resistant up to 950° C.
